Argentina Travel Packages

Argentina … just the mention of this destination brings to mind images of wine, gauchos and TANGO! The awesome power and beauty of 275 waterfalls at Iguzu is a must on everyone’s itinerary. The Andean mountain chain offers some of the best trekking in the world. Wildlife is abundant from whales and elephant seals to penguin and dolphin pods along the Patagonian coast. For the wine lover (or anyone else for that matter) the vineyards of the Mendoza and the welsh tea rooms of the Chubut valley makes the mouth water. But don’t forget the meat, barbequed on open wood fires for a tantalizing end of a perfect day!

More than sixty kilometers / 45 miles of runs provide skiers and snowboarders with descents of varying difficulties suitable for skiers and riders of all abilities, from a height of 11,253 feet above sea level to the base at at elevation of 7,349 feet. The vertical drop of the lift-served in-bounds area of Las Lenas ski resort is a hefty 4,035 feet, with gradients ranking from 12% to 53%.


Las Lenas has the the most modern lift system in South America. Lift lines are extremely rare at Las Lenas, since the mountain has 16 modern ski lifts that boast a total uphill capacity of 9200 skiers per hour. Ski lifts are named after Roman and Greek Gods: Venus, Eros, Minerva, Vesta, Vulcano, Jupiter, Apolo, Neptuno, Mercurio, Caris, Selene, Juno, Iris, Marte, Urano, and Cenidor. Lifts run nonstop from 9am to 5pm daily...Read More
